Is a floodlight 2000 lumens bright enough?
With the continuous progress of technology and the increasing demand for comfort, the lighting market has gradually developed various types of lamps. Among them, floodlights, as a widely used lighting device in indoor and outdoor scenes, have received much attention and praise. However, the brightness of a floodlight, especially whether the brightness of 2000 lumens is sufficient, has become a concern for many consumers.
To answer this question, we first need to understand what a brightness of 2000 lumens actually means. Lumen is the standard unit of light emitted per second. Simply put, the higher the lumen, the better the lighting effect and the brighter the environment.
Lighting manufacturers often rate the brightness of their lights in lumens. However, some manufacturers rate their lights in watts, which may cause some confusion. It is worth noting that watt is a measure of the energy consumed per second; Incandescent bulbs may consume 100 watts and provide 1600 lumens, while LED lamps have much higher efficiency.
The brightness of a floodlight depends on multiple factors, including the power of the lamp, the type and number of beads, and the design of the reflector. Therefore, based solely on the value of 2000 lumens, the brightness of floodlights is relatively high, sufficient to meet the lighting needs of most homes and commercial places. Whether in the living room, bedroom, or office, a 2000 lumen floodlight can provide sufficient bright light to meet the requirements of general daily activities.
However, it should be noted that for individual locations or special needs, a brightness of 2000 lumens may not be sufficient. For example, in scenes that require high illumination such as exhibition halls and concert venues, higher brightness floodlights may be required. In addition, for people with weaker vision, a brightness of 2000 lumens may appear somewhat less bright, and they may need higher brightness lighting equipment to provide a better visual environment.

A 2000 lumen solar lamp will be brighter than most LED solar lamps on the market. Please remember that the higher the brightness, the more rechargeable batteries are required, and these batteries need to be large enough to provide them with sufficient time. Be sure to check the expected operating time for each full charge.
